#BattleOfBosworth spoils seized incl. Richard’s personal Book of Hours, #LambethPalaceLibrary MS 474, likely given to #MargaretBeaufort. The #mss was modified and show signs of continued devotional use incl. #RichardIII’s name erasure where he'd originally been identified as Ricardum regem.
